Distributed graph calculation method, terminal, distributed graph calculation system and storage medium

A distributed and graph computing technology, applied in the field of graph computing, can solve problems such as high energy consumption, time-consuming, and low-quality partitions in the partition stage, and achieve the effect of reducing communication overhead and speeding up calculation and analysis

Active Publication Date: 2020-08-25
SOUTH UNIVERSITY OF SCIENCE AND TECHNOLOGY OF CHINA
View PDF5 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, when doing distributed graph computing, high-quality partitioning methods consume a lot of time in computing, resulting in high energy consumption in the partitioning stage
Conversely, high-speed generation of partitions will result in low-quality partitions, causing severe performance loss

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Distributed graph calculation method, terminal, distributed graph calculation system and storage medium
  • Distributed graph calculation method, terminal, distributed graph calculation system and storage medium
  • Distributed graph calculation method, terminal, distributed graph calculation system and storage medium

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0066] In order to make the purpose, technical solution and advantages of the present application clearer, the present application will be further described in detail below in conjunction with the accompanying drawings and embodiments. It should be understood that the specific embodiments described here are only used to explain the present application, not to limit the present application.

[0067] It should be noted that although the functional modules are divided in the schematic diagram of the device, and the logical sequence is shown in the flowchart, in some cases, it can be executed in a different order than the module division in the device or the flowchart in the flowchart. steps shown or described. The terms "first", "second" and the like in the specification and claims and the above drawings are used to distinguish similar objects, and not necessarily used to describe a specific sequence or sequence.

[0068] In the distributed graph computing technology of the known 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a distributed graph calculation method, a terminal, a distributed graph calculation system and a storage medium. The embodiment of the invention is based on graph data preprocessing, a graph division algorithm and an incremental graph edge sorting algorithm. According to the method, the original graph data is converted into the computer readable intermediate graph data, sothat subsequent graph division can be performed quickly, high-quality graph division is provided, the communication overhead of the generated high-quality partition is greatly reduced, and the calculation and analysis speed of the distributed graph is increased.

Description

technical field [0001] The embodiments of the present application relate to but are not limited to the technical field of graph computing, and in particular, relate to a distributed graph computing method, terminal, system, and storage medium. Background technique [0002] As the demand for data analysis continues to grow, such as deep mining of data relationships, large-scale graph computing has thus received considerable attention in many fields. Graph is an abstract data structure used to represent the relationship between objects. It is described by Vertex and Edge. The vertex represents the object and the edge represents the relationship between the objects. Based on this, the data that can be abstracted to be described by graphs is graph data. Graph computing is the process of expressing and solving problems using graphs as data models. [0003] Currently, distributed computing is used to analyze large-scale graph data as the size of graphs has been growing. When us...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F16/901
CPCG06F16/9024Y02D10/00
Inventor 华井雅俊乔治斯·泽奥多洛保罗斯
Owner SOUTH UNIVERSITY OF SCIENCE AND TECHNOLOGY OF CHINA
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products